Large-Scale Changes in Colour: 4 to 6 Weeks in Advance

Whether transitioning from dark brown hair colour to blonde, repairing an existing colouring job, or changing colours to a vibrant colour, will require ample time in advance. Large changes in hair colour do not occur easily without proper processing.

Scheduling 4 to 6 weeks ahead of time will give you peace of mind in case your hair requires another appointment to achieve the desired colour. Also, a large change in hair colour can look very striking on the first day. A month gives enough time for a few washes at home in order to soften the colour.

Routine Refreshes and Balayage: Book 1 to 2 Weeks Out

In case of regular hair maintenance like grey root cover-up, retouching of balayage hair, or adding highlights to already highlighted hair, the best period to wait is just about a week or two before the big day.

Why? It hits the perfect balance between freshness and comfort. You won't have to worry about dark or silver roots peeking through in event photos, yet you won't be dealing with a freshly stained forehead either. Two or three home shampoos between your appointment and the event date will clear away any tint left on your scalp along the hairline. It also lets the fresh pigment soften just enough to complement your skin tone without looking raw or over-processed.

The Unseen Risks of Last-Minute Appointments (1 to 3 Days Before)

It’s tempting to book your appointment right before the big day so your hair feels "as fresh as possible." But squeezing in a colour treatment forty-eight hours before an event is an unnecessary gamble.

The first one is the staining left by the fresh colour. Duller tones tend to stain the hairline and hair parting area in a few washes. The second reason is that if the toner is slightly darker or ashier than expected, you don’t get a chance to rectify it. Thirdly, coloured hair cuticles tend to be slippery or sensitive, making it difficult to create formal updos, smooth blow dries or hot curlers. Personal Details That Can Shift Your Timeline

Not every head of hair behaves the same way, so a few personal factors might shift your calendar slightly:

  • Hair Health and Porosity of Hair: Dull hair that is dry or has been bleached earlier will take the colour instantly and fade quickly. If your hair is porous, schedule one week ahead so that you can get a deep conditioning done before the function.
  • Flash Photography: Cameras with high-resolution capabilities and bright party lights accentuate the sharpness and brassy look of the skin. Bleached hair tends to be particularly brassy when photographed right after being bleached, because it takes a week to set in.
  • Warm Vs.  Cool Shades: Cool shades like platinum and ash fade quicker than warm shades like brunettes. When you have a cool shade on, make sure to stay within the 7-to-10-day range to avoid any brassiness.
